+/**
+ * QCryptoTLSCredsAnon:
+ *
+ * The QCryptoTLSCredsAnon object provides a representation
+ * of anonymous credentials used perform a TLS handshake.
+ * This is primarily provided for backwards compatibility and
+ * its use is discouraged as it has poor security characteristics
+ * due to lacking MITM attack protection amongst other problems.
+ *
+ * This is a user creatable object, which can be instantiated
+ * via object_new_propv():
+ *
+ * <example>
+ *   <title>Creating anonymous TLS credential objects in code</title>
+ *   <programlisting>
+ *   Object *obj;
+ *   Error *err = NULL;
+ *   obj = object_new_propv(TYPE_QCRYPTO_TLS_CREDS_ANON,
+ *                          "tlscreds0",
+ *                          &err,
+ *                          "endpoint", "server",
+ *                          "dir", "/path/x509/cert/dir",
+ *                          "verify-peer", "yes",
+ *                          NULL);
+ *   </programlisting>
+ * </example>
+ *
+ * Or via QMP:
+ *
+ * <example>
+ *   <title>Creating anonymous TLS credential objects via QMP</title>
+ *   <programlisting>
+ *    {
+ *       "execute": "object-add", "arguments": {
+ *          "id": "tlscreds0",
+ *          "qom-type": "tls-creds-anon",
+ *          "props": {
+ *             "endpoint": "server",
+ *             "dir": "/path/to/x509/cert/dir",
+ *             "verify-peer": false
+ *          }
+ *       }
+ *    }
+ *   </programlisting>
+ * </example>
+ *
+ *
+ * Or via the CLI:
+ *
+ * <example>
+ *   <title>Creating anonymous TLS credential objects via CLI</title>
+ *   <programlisting>
+ *  qemu-system-x86_64 -object tls-creds-anon,id=tlscreds0,\
+ *          endpoint=server,verify-peer=off,\
+ *          dir=/path/to/x509/certdir/
+ *   </programlisting>
+ * </example>
+ *
+ */

+@item -object tls-creds-anon,id=@var{id},endpoint=@var{endpoint},dir=@var{/path/to/cred/dir},verify-peer=@var{on|off}
+
+Creates a TLS anonymous credentials object, which can be used to provide
+TLS support on network backends. The @option{id} parameter is a unique
+ID which network backends will use to access the credentials. The
+@option{endpoint} is either @option{server} or @option{client} depending
+on whether the QEMU network backend that uses the credentials will be
+acting as a client or as a server. If @option{verify-peer} is enabled
+(the default) then once the handshake is completed, the peer credentials
+will be verified, though this is a no-op for anonymous credentials.
+
+The @var{dir} parameter tells QEMU where to find the credential
+files. For server endpoints, this directory may contain a file
+@var{dh-params.pem} providing diffie-hellman parameters to use
+for the TLS server. If the file is missing, QEMU will generate
+a set of DH parameters at startup. This is a computationally
+expensive operation that consumes random pool entropy, so it is
+recommended that a persistent set of parameters be generated
+upfront and saved.
